Business/Corporate Communications is the 240th most popular major in the country with 1,029 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, business/corporate communications gra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$37,176 and had an average of $25,350 in loans still to pay off.

Across Minnesota, there were 11 business/corporate communications gra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$33,293 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 9 business/corporate communications gra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,526 and $26,035 respectively.

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
